Transaction 742527818f68b281027cc9e9a3ce57408853509c87d611cea1b17805030fc109
1 Input
1 Output
-
742527818f68b281027cc9e9a3ce57408853509c87d611cea1b17805030fc109:0
- value
- 159528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b0f757ad74616efc07841d48f8d4cf77fde3dfe OP_EQUAL
- address
- 3BT6kAzuoTQn2N3aBGfWgCQr2juJTgziNs